     > is it normal that when a process is stoppped (ctrl-z ;-) and he
     > has locks on a nfs-server

Yes. ctrl-z will normally suspend the process. It does nothing to kill
it...

     > if this nfs server reboot the stopped process does'nt reclaim
     > it's locks ?!!!

Why not? That's a separate thread...
